Relating the independence number and the dissociation number
arXiv:2205.03404
Abstract
The independence number and the dissociation number of a graph are the largest orders of induced subgraphs of of maximum degree at most and at most , respectively. We consider possible improvements of the obvious inequality . For connected cubic graphs distinct from , we show , and describe the rich and interesting structure of the extremal graphs in detail. For bipartite graphs, and, more generally, triangle-free graphs, we also obtain improvements. For subcubic graphs though, the inequality cannot be improved in general, and we characterize all extremal subcubic graphs.
